A sink has two faucets: one for hot water and one for cold water. The sink can be filled by a cold water faucet in 4 minutes. If
mojhsa [17]

Answer:

Given:

Cold water faucet fills the sink in 4 minutes.

Both faucets fills the sink in 3 minutes.

Let us assume that "t" be the time it takes hot water faucet in order to fill the sink.

Therefore;

<em>Rate for hot water faucet fills the sink = \frac{1}{time} = \frac{1}{t} </em>

<em>Rate at which cold water faucet fills the sink = \frac{1}{time} = \frac{1}{4} </em>

When both faucets are used , the rate at which they fill the sink is given as :

<em>\frac{1}{t} + \frac{1}{4} = \frac{1}{3} </em>

On solving the above equation, we get :

<em>4t = 3t +12</em>

<em>∴ t = 12\ minutes</em>

<em>Therefore, it takes 12 minutes for the hot water faucet to fill the sink.</em>

identify the reasons criminologists have proposed to explain the dramatic drop in crime in the united states since the 1990s.
damaskus [11]

Criminologists have argued that the decrease in crimes is due to various social factors such as greater surveillance, more prisons, among others.

Delinquency is a term that refers to the act of committing a crime, that is, committing a crime or breaking the law.

During the 1990s, crime declined in the United States and expert criminologists give several explanations for this phenomenon:

  • Decrease in demand for Crack
  • Acting forcefully by the police forces
  • Improvement plans in crime areas in cities
  • Access to legal abortions since the 70s
  • Increased capture and incarceration of criminals
  • An increase in video games for young people and children kept them away from the streets and crime
